2013-03-26 78 views
0

我想通過私有云中的監視工具監視AWS上託管的應用程序的性能。如何從私有云與AWS EC2實例進行通信?

在私有云和亞馬遜雲之間建立成功連接所需遵循的各種步驟是什麼?

+0

當你說私有云你在談論亞馬遜VPC?或aws之外的環境? – datasage 2013-03-26 12:57:07

+0

爲了補充問題,你在說什麼監控工具? – Guy 2013-03-26 17:43:48

+0

@datasage:aws之外的環境。 – APMFreak 2013-04-12 05:41:43

回答

2

那麼,如果您的EC2實例不在亞馬遜VPC內部,那麼EC2安全組只控制入站連接。因此,如果您需要從VPC連接到EC2,則需要在EC2安全組中打開必要的端口。

另一種選擇是,如果您不想打開ec2安全組上的端口,則可以使用SNS在EC2和VPC之間進行通信。例如,您的ec2將消息放入SNS。SNS將消息放入SQS隊列。 VPC上的服務定時從SQS中提取消息並在您的監控工具中處理它們。

+0

實際上,我想將AWS連接到AWS以外的環境。一個不同的私有云在一起。 – APMFreak 2013-04-12 05:44:42

1

Basicall AWS雲與您構建的任何其他網絡(或服務器)相似。因此,要連接它進行SNMP監控,您需要在安全組中打開SNMP端口(161和162)。所以基本上你會編輯入站規則併爲應用程序所在的AWS服務器的安全組添加udp端口161和162。但是,您構建的服務器也需要改動防火牆配置。在Linux服務器上,您還需要編輯iptables以允許此類流量,Windows具有其防火牆設置等等。但正如其他人所說,你可能想提供這樣的監測工具,你正在使用等。